Can a radish withstand a light frost?

Yes, radishes can generally withstand light frost, as they are considered hardy vegetables. They can tolerate temperatures as low as 28°F (-2°C) for short periods. However, a hard freeze or prolonged exposure to very cold temperatures can damage the plants and affect their growth. It's best to provide some protection if a more severe frost is expected.
